What The Telecrane Remote Control F24-6D Is For

The F24-6D is a double speed radio remote control for overhead cranes and lifting equipment, supplied as a matched transmitter and receiver pair. Six function buttons provide double speed control for hoist and trolley motions, with a dedicated start button and a large mushroom emergency stop. The set operates up to 100 metres with 80 channels across VHF 310-331 MHz or UHF 425-441 MHz, and both units are rated IP65 for protection against dust and water. Receiver voltage is built to order from DC12V, DC24V, AC36V, AC48V, AC110V, AC220V or AC380V, so it connects directly to an existing control panel without a transformer.

Technical Features

How The Unit Is Built

  • 10 push buttons: 6 double speed function buttons, 1 start button, 1 emergency stop, 1 on/off switch
  • 12 control motions from the six double speed buttons
  • Transmitter LED flashes green while battery power is sufficient and red when depleted
  • Glass fibre housing on both transmitter and receiver
  • Mushroom emergency stop with removable waterproof key
  • Operating frequency available in VHF 310-331 MHz or UHF 425-441 MHz

Comparison

How It Compares With The Alternatives

Wired pendant control stationRadio removes the trailing cable but adds batteries to change and a receiver to wire in; a pendant is cheaper and never needs pairing
F24-8D with eight buttonsThe 6D has two fewer double speed motions; if the machine only needs hoist, trolley and start, the 6D is the simpler, lower-cost fit
Joystick sets such as F24-60Push buttons are faster to train an operator on; a joystick gives proportional control that push buttons cannot
Use Guide

Getting It Onto The Machine

  • Confirm the control voltage on the existing crane panel before ordering the receiver
  • Count the motions the machine actually needs, then choose the button count with one spare
  • Mount the receiver inside the panel with the 1 m cable running to the contactor terminals
  • Watch the transmitter LED: slow red flashing means change the two batteries
  • Record the S/N and channel from the back of both units so a lost transmitter can be replaced without changing the receiver

Which receiver voltage should I order?

Match the control voltage on the crane panel. The receiver is built for DC12V, DC24V, AC36V, AC48V, AC110V, AC220V or AC380V, so tell us the panel voltage with the order.

Can I get a replacement transmitter only?

Yes. Send the S/N and CH printed on the back of your receiver and we build a new transmitter on the same channel, so the receiver stays in place.

Will two cranes in the same bay interfere?

Each set is coded with one of over 4.3 billion unique ID codes and runs on 80 channels, so a transmitter only answers its own paired receiver.
